How Our Bathtub Overflow Water Removal Process Works
When you call us, we’ll dispatch a team of technicians to your location within 60 minutes. Our emergency response process is designed to reduce downtime and prevent secondary damage. We’ll assess the situation, extract water, and begin the drying process using industrial-grade equipment like desiccant dehumidifiers and air movers.
Step 1: Emergency Response and Assessment
We’ll arrive within 60 minutes to assess the damage and develop a customized plan.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ract water from your tub and surrounding areas.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Removal
We’ll use a submersible pump to remove standing water from your tub and surrounding areas. Our team will also use wet vacuums to extract water from carpets, upholstery, and other materials.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ll deploy desiccant dehumidifiers to remove moisture from the air and industrial-grade air movers to speed up the drying process. Our goal is to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We’ll use EPA-registered disinfectants to sanitize and disinfect the affected area, removing bacteria, viruses, and other microorganisms that can cause illness.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Restoration
We’ll conduct a thorough inspection to ensure the area is dry, clean, and safe. Our team will also provide recommendations for any necessary repairs or replacements to get your home back to normal.

Bathtub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ill in a well-ventilated area | Yes | No | You can contain the spill and dry the area yourself. |
| Large water spill in a confined space | No | Yes | The risk of mold growth and secondary damage is too high for a DIY solution. |
| Water damage to walls or ceilings |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are needed to safely and effectively address the issue. |
| Musty odors or visible signs of mold growth | No | Yes | Mold can spread quickly and cause serious health issues, don’t try to tackle it yourself. |
| Water damage to electrical or gas systems | No | Yes | Professional expertise is needed to safely and effectively address the issue. |

Bathtub Overflow Water Removal Cost in Mansfield, MA
The cost of bathtub overflow water removal in Mansfield, MA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on the specifics of your situation and may include: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Response and Assessment | $200 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Water Extraction and Removal | $500 – $2,000 | Amount of water, type of flooring or materials |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$500 – $1,000 | Type of disinfectants used, size of affected area |
| Final Inspection and Restoration | $1,000 – $2,000 | Complexity of repairs, type of materials used |
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ment and may vary based on the specifics of your situation. We offer free estimates and are happy to discuss your needs and concerns with you.
